Dave Birkett of the Detroit Free Press writes that Lions RB Jahvid Best “isn’t expected to play football again” after he was unable to gain medical clearance from doctors last season.
Best suffered a serious concussion while in college as well two more in 2011. Lions general manager Martin Mayhew mentioned that his biggest regret from last season was not finding an adequate replacement for Best.
“We need that shifty back that can come in and be that change-of-pace guy who can catch passes out of the backfield, a guy that can run routes and get one-on-one with a linebacker,” Mayhew said. “That’s what Jahvid gave us, a guy with some juice, some elusiveness.“
The Lions coaching staff is working with the South team at this year’s Senior Bowl, so they have should have a good idea of Stanford’s Stepfan Taylor and Florida’s Mike Gillislee overall skill sets. It seems safe to suggest that the Lions will consider finding a replacement for Best at some point during this year’s NFL draft.
